Background technology
With the fast development of China's animal husbandry, substantial amounts of livestock and poultry farms in scale has been built in big or middle surrounding city,
Animal fecal pollution sewage without any processing flows directly into river, lake, can cause substantial amounts of N and P losses, causes water body dirty
Dye and eutrophication, damage natural ecological environment.At present, the processing to swine manure wastewater common are:Anaerobism is sent out
Ferment, directly apply fertilizer.Anaerobic fermentation investment is big, land occupation area is big, and the equipment used is considerably complicated, complicated, for one
As raiser for be hardly formed scale;Cultivation fecal sewage is directly applied, crop will be produced and hinder root, disease, crop smothering etc.
Negative effect, and comprehensive utilization ratio is low.Reaction unit will be continuously stirred at present and is used for the also seldom of livestock and poultry liquid dung processing, is needed
Further develop and use.

Conduction oil is stored in oil storage tank, and cold oil enters solar energy heat conducting oil thermal-collecting tube 1 by circulating pump 1, in the sun
After absorbing heat to assigned temperature in energy conduction oil thermal-collecting tube 1, deep fat is returned in oil storage tank 2.Deep fat is pumped by circulating pump 2 16
Enter to continuously stir the conduction oil heating coil pipe 19 of reaction unit 3, conduction oil heating coil pipe 19 is with continuously stirring in reaction unit 3
Sewage comes into full contact with transmission heat, and sewage, which is warming up to after assigned temperature, occurs anaerobic reaction, leading in conduction oil heating coil pipe 19
Deep fat after heat is transmitted oil return to oil storage tank 2., should if expanding chamber 4 one to expand spilling after preventing conduction oil thermal-arrest
Device carries out heat supply when wet weather, solar-heating are insufficient using a set of combustion gas auxiliary device 5, continuously stirs reaction unit 3 and exists
The biogas produced in processing procedure can be used as the supplement energy of combustion gas auxiliary device 5 after treatment.
